What is another word for more recreative?

Pronunciation: [mˈɔː ɹˈɛkɹi͡ətˌɪv] (IPA)

There are plenty of synonyms for the phrase "more recreative." Some examples include "more relaxing," "more enjoyable," "more rejuvenating," "more entertaining," and "more fun." Depending on the context, other options could include "more engaging," "more fulfilling," "more refreshing," or "more invigorating." These synonyms describe something that is pleasurable or satisfying and can be used to describe a variety of activities, from leisurely reading or watching movies to participating in sports or outdoor adventures. Ultimately, the choice of synonym will depend on the specific activity in question and the desired effect it should have on the participant.

What are the opposite words for more recreative?

The antonyms for the word "more recreative" are "less enjoyable," "unstimulating," "boring," and "tedious." These words are antonyms as they represent the opposite meaning of "more recreative," which implies a heightened state of pleasure or entertainment. While "more recreative" implies an increase in enjoyment or leisure, its antonyms suggest a decrease in such activities or experiences.
